Discover MM88’s Gaming Universe MM88 is home to one of the most diverse gaming collections online. Thanks to its smooth and intuitive interface, MM88 makes exploring games simple and enjoyable. At MM88, players find both classic favorites and innovative new releases. All-in-One Entertainment Hub From sports betting to live dealers, slots t… Read More